Original german concept art, artist Boris Streimann (1908-1984). Pastel, gouache and pencil on light cardboard. Widely considered Frank Borzage's finest directorial work, it is also frequently named 'the most erotic film of the silent era'. It has been heavily censored around the world. The film was never released in Germany and the absence of a censor stamp clearly indicates that the german censors outright refused a release.
